The present Office and Storage Rooms on the north side of the Entrance <br />Foyer will be remodeled to provide a Handicapped Entrance and Men's and <br />Women's Toilet Rooms. The Toilet Rooms will meet ADA requirements and <br />contain one water closet and one lavatory per room for use by the <br />disabled. The temperature control panel will be relocated. Plumbing <br />piping will be connected to existing piping in the basement. <br />Supplementary Services: The following work is defined as additional services if <br />requested by the Owner. <br />1.
